According to a scientist who was working with fetal tissue and spoke at the PAN seminar a year ago...they need tissue from at least 7 (seven) different fetuses for one transplant and many do not have acceptable tissue. That excludes the possibility of someone getting pregnant to have an abortion in order to donate the tissue. nina brown 56/11 Camilla Flintermann wrote: > > Dear Ruth-- I just re-read your post, below, and realized that you seem to > be assuming that fetal tissue research to cure PD implies abortions would > be performed specifically for that research.
